Summer is the perfect time for students to get back on track with their academic plan or get ahead with electives and general education requirements. With a mix of online and blended hybrid course options, Middlesex has a plan in place to help students meet their goals and have a productive and successful summer. MCC offers flexible schedules, high-quality courses and affordable prices. Summer semester starts on Tuesday, June 1.
"MCC summer courses can help you stay on track and complete your degree on time,” said Maria Gonzalez, MCC Academic Advisor. “For example, if you need to take a particular course in the Fall, you could take the prerequisite course for it in the summer – helping you finish the requirements you need to complete without delay."

During the Summer semester, students of all ages can take classes to improve their GPA, finish their degree faster, earn transferable college credits and get an early start on their education. Ellen Grondine, MCC’s Dean of Education & K-16 Partnerships, encourages high school students to enroll in summer courses at Middlesex as soon as possible. After a year of remote learning, MCC can help high school students get college ready.
“Many high school students take advantage of the summer months to tackle a college-level course that may need a little extra attention and focus,” Grondine said. “The time spent this summer will save time later as students are earning college credits and meeting high school graduation requirements. Courses fill fast, so planning ahead can really make all the difference.”
MCC’s Summer sessions offer a variety of course subjects, from art to anthropology; the performing arts to business; communications to criminal justice; education to English; health to science, technology, engineering and mathematics (STEM); and so much more. With accelerated sessions, Middlesex helps students fit education into their busy lives.
"Taking summer classes at MCC is a smart and fast way to get classes completed in either three-, five- or eight-week sessions,” said Josselyn Porter, MCC Academic Advisor. “This can lighten your load for Fall and Spring, and get you to graduation quicker.”
The three-week Summer QuickStart Session will run from June 1 to June 18. Summer Session One is five weeks and runs June 1 to July 1; Summer Session Two is eight weeks, running June 1 to July 28; and Summer Session Three will run for five weeks from July 13 to August 12.

The Summer 2021 semester will run via three primary learning modalities – online with class meeting times, online with no class meeting times and online with on-campus lab.
Students taking courses online with class meeting times have fully online classes with scheduled meeting days and times. In online classes with no class meeting times, students have fully online classes with no scheduled meeting days or times as their lectures, lessons and exercises are completed online, over the course of the semester.
Online and on-campus lab courses combine online instruction and on-campus labs, and follow strict health and safety guidelines such as social distancing and mask wearing.
